Overview

A biomass compressor is a specialized machine used to compact loose biomass materials into denser, more manageable forms such as briquettes or pellets. These machines are crucial in industries dealing with agricultural residues, forestry by-products, and other organic waste materials. The primary purpose of a biomass compressor is to reduce the volume of biomass, making it easier and more cost-effective to store, transport, and utilize. This process also enhances the combustion efficiency of biomass when used as a fuel source.

Structure and Working Principle

Biomass compressors typically consist of a feeding hopper, compression chamber, hydraulic or mechanical press, and a discharge system. The feeding hopper introduces the raw biomass material into the compression chamber, where high pressure is applied to compact it into the desired shape. The working principle involves applying mechanical or hydraulic force to the biomass, forcing it through a die or mold to form uniform briquettes or pellets. Some advanced models include heating elements to facilitate binding of lignin in the biomass, improving the durability of the compressed product.

Key Features

Modern biomass compressors are designed with several key features to enhance performance and efficiency. High compression ratios ensure maximum density of the output product, while durable construction materials like hardened steel resist wear and prolong machine life. Energy efficiency is another critical feature, with many models incorporating variable speed drives and optimized compression cycles to minimize power consumption. Additionally, user-friendly controls and safety mechanisms are standard in most industrial-grade biomass compressors.

Application Areas

Biomass compressors are widely used in agriculture for processing crop residues like straw, rice husks, and corn stalks. In forestry, they help manage wood chips, sawdust, and bark, converting these by-products into valuable fuel sources. The renewable energy sector heavily relies on biomass compressors to produce biomass pellets and briquettes for use in boilers, stoves, and power plants. These compressed biomass products are also used in animal bedding and as raw materials for further industrial processing.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and efficiency of a biomass compressor. Key maintenance tasks include lubricating moving parts, inspecting and replacing worn dies or molds, and checking hydraulic systems for leaks. Operators should also monitor the moisture content of the biomass material, as excessive moisture can affect compression quality and increase wear on the machine. Proper training for operators is crucial to prevent accidents and ensure optimal performance.

B2B Procurement Guide

When procuring a biomass compressor for industrial use, several factors should be considered. The machine's capacity should align with the volume of biomass to be processed, and the compression ratio should meet the desired density of the final product. It's also important to evaluate the supplier's reputation, availability of spare parts, and after-sales service. Comparing energy consumption rates and operational costs among different models can help in making a cost-effective decision.
